    Description

      For an attribute definition, if it is of type "permission", then add a "More actions" menu item that is "Visualization"

      That subpage should allow two possibilities

      1. Visualize action directed graph (another jira)
      2. Visualize permission name directed graph

      Here is example from legacy applet just for reference, doesnt need to be anything like this

      https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=DzBvOteaXJM

      Attribute names that are from a permission def which is of type "permission" should have a Visualize button in the "More actions" that visualizes that one permission name in both directions (implies and implied by)

      These visualizations should have similar controls as the other visualizations where it has max elements (e.g. 1000), and can share or have other configs as needed.  Simpler the better though

      Link the visualization from the resource hierarchy screen
